Re: On new names for "Deity"
Bruce
I see the problem. Most people using this will be seeing a GUI of
some sort. May I suggest that the new name for deity be
"administration/packaging tool" or "apt" for short.
[acronym not specifically intended but perhaps appropriate.]
This means that any distributions can use this: the phrase is
generic so non-copyright. Any manual for any software distribution
can refer to this directly e.g. "the administration/packaging tool
can be accessed by clicking on ..." and apropos "administration"
"packaging" or "tools" could give a pointer.
If you inadvertently close the icon/GUI, then perhaps typing "apt"
could reopen this.
This is fine for English: any localisation efforts can simply
translate the phrase into the appropriate language. As for the
icon, I suggest a big red box with yellow ribbons or a brown paper
package tied up with string.
I'm currently learning Arabic, so see the problems for non-English
speakers / non-English script only too clearly.
